Transaction 2c77b8483d35e22e4bc8f17239a21cf876652416994f6c517db6f1da9f98e331
3 Input
2 Outputs
- 2c77b8483d35e22e4bc8f17239a21cf876652416994f6c517db6f1da9f98e331:0
- 2c77b8483d35e22e4bc8f17239a21cf876652416994f6c517db6f1da9f98e331:1
value 163653
address 1PkxTrfH3KFJm9YwVb9i9qyhjnaP25C9Ze
value 24946245
address 1JUPGPQE4o9WppFUWYd4SMap35JL13gi9E